ventech Wrote:two questions:
1. is there no notion of a tree in this dom parser? Say i want to get an element based on some info from one of it's children. In beautiful soup you just walk to the parent, but how can i do this with parseDOM?
2. Is it possible to use regex in attributes? E.g. I want to match the class "somethingsomething-toggle-something" so I write {"class":".*toggle.*"} but it seems to just completely ignore the attribute and match everything.
1. There is no way to "Walk" the tree.
2. It should be possible to do "toggle.*". I will investigate and fix for 0.9.1.
